Investment Philosophy

This strategy is comprised of individual municipal securities that pay interest that is exempt from regular federal personal income taxes. It seeks to generate current income and capital appreciation while maintaining an intermediate duration profile, and focuses on municipal securities within the investment grade spectrum that we believe offer greater yield opportunities as well as attractive total return potential.

  • After-Tax Income Potential

    The municipal securities market may offer the potential for higher after-tax income when compared with other fixed income markets.

  6. Municipal bonds are subject to credit risk, interest rate risk, liquidity risk, and call risk. However, the obligations of some municipal issuers may not be enforceable through the exercise of traditional creditors’ rights. The reorganization under federal bankruptcy laws of a municipal bond issuer may result in the bonds being cancelled without payment or repaid only in part, or in delays in collecting principal and interest.
